Android – How to send callers directly to voicemail

November 19th, 2012 No comments

For the last week or so I have been receiving annoying telemarketing calls. Today a found a real simple way to automatically re-direct these annoying calls to voicemail.

The following steps describe how to set this up in Android 4.1.2 (Jelly Bean).

  • Step 1– Navigate to the “People” application.

  • Step 2– Select the contact you wish to automatically re-direct to voicemail.

  • Step 3– Select the checkbox and exit.

New BlackDog Service

July 18th, 2010 No comments

I thought I’d mention a new product that we’ve been working on in our spare time. It is a service that allows iphone and android developers to keep data on the phones in sync with a master database.

It is very easy to use, is free to use, and is hosted on the BlackDog Foundry. The basic gist is that you log on to the BlackDog website and save the baseline data for your database. You then link in some iphone or android libraries on the device, and make a simple one-line call that will fetch new or changed records. It handles both incremental and full replications.
